This isn’t to say I hadn’t edited the book prior to the query journey. But this is the first time I’ve looked at the book in almost 3 months. I mean, really read it start to finish. I have to say, I can’t recommend this enough if you’ve written a book yourself. Once you’re done and you’ve done a few edits you feel good with? Move on to the next project. Don’t even think about the recently completed book for a month or two (I think Stephen King suggests similar in On Writing).

You really do come back to it with a fresh pair of eyes. There were a couple parts where I was like…”Huh…just what the hell was I trying to say there?” “That makes no sense!”
